Still the winner for aesthetic, finished-looking images.
DALL-E 3 follows prompts more literally, but Midjourney v6 produces images with real composition, lighting, and mood — things we don't want to have to 'prompt in.' For cover art, hero images, and anything you need to look intentional, it stays ahead.
Best for
Designers, marketers, and content creators who care how the final image looks, not just what's in it.
Honest caveat
Discord-only for basic plans is still awkward. Text inside images is unreliable — DALL-E handles that better.

Overview
Midjourney is the gold standard for AI image generation, trusted by over 14 million users to create stunning visual content. Using sophisticated diffusion models, it transforms text prompts into photorealistic, artistic, and experimental images. Launched in 2022, Midjourney operates through Discord and a web interface, making it accessible to creators without design software. In our testing, Midjourney consistently outperformed competitors on artistic quality and style consistency. For marketing teams, it generates hero images, product mockups, and ad variations in minutes. For designers, it accelerates ideation and prototyping. For illustrators, it produces reference art and explores style directions faster than sketching. What makes Midjourney stand out in 2026 is its community and usability. Discord integration feels natural. The upscaling quality preserves fine details (textures, lighting, shadows). Version 6 introduced photorealism that rivals stock photography. Style consistency—generating multiple variations of the same subject that feel cohesive—is superior to competitors. The main differentiators: Midjourney's community model (shared gallery of 50M+ images) drives continuous improvement. Its pricing is predictable (monthly subscription) vs. DALL-E's per-image credits. However, it lacks API access, doesn't generate videos, and has a learning curve for prompt engineering. For teams, licensing and commercial usage clarity is sometimes ambiguous.

Detailed Feature Breakdown
Midjourney's Version 6 (released late 2025) represents a major leap in photorealism. The diffusion model now understands complex lighting, material textures, and depth-of-field effects that previously required photoshop skills. In our testing, Version 6 generated images virtually indistinguishable from professional stock photography. A sunset over mountains, a portrait with natural skin tones and eye detail, a product shot with realistic shadows—all emerged from text prompts with minimal tweaking.
The --sref (style reference) parameter is transformative for professionals. Instead of dialing in the same aesthetic for every image, you lock a reference style and all subsequent generations inherit that look. This enables consistent marketing campaigns where 20 hero images feel like a cohesive series. One marketing agency told us this feature alone reduced art direction time by 60%.
Prompt weighting lets you fine-tune composition. Instead of writing "a sunset with orange sky and blue ocean"—which might over-emphasize blue—you write "orange sunset::2 blue ocean::1", assigning relative weights. This syntax gives creators precision. Weights range from 0.1 to 2.0, with 1.0 as baseline.
The upscaling quality is exceptional. Enlarging from 1024x1024 to 4096x4096 sharpens textures (fabric weave, skin pores, tree bark) and adds realistic fine details (light reflection on metal, shadow gradations). This level of detail makes upscaled images suitable for print (billboards, magazine covers) without additional post-processing.
Niji mode specializes in anime and illustration, a niche DALL-E and Stable Diffusion struggle with. If you need manga covers, anime character art, or watercolor illustrations, Niji's quality is unmatched. For Western artists exploring animation styles, this is the fastest route to reference material.
Real-World Use Cases
If you're a small marketing team without a designer, Midjourney is transformative. Generate 5 variations of a hero image in 3 minutes, choose the best, upscale, and it's production-ready. One consultant used Midjourney to create a 12-image marketing campaign for a product launch—cost: $15 (monthly Standard plan). Traditional cost: $2400 (20 hours designer time at $120/hour).
If you're an author or self-publisher, Midjourney accelerates cover design. Describe your book concept, generate 10 variations, explore different moods (dark vs. bright, minimalist vs. detailed), and pick a direction before commissioning a designer. Or use the generated cover directly if you like it. One indie author saved $800 by using Midjourney instead of hiring a cover designer.
If you're an architect or interior designer, Midjourney visualizes client concepts. Show a client a photorealistic image of their living room redesign in 2 minutes rather than sketching for hours. This shortens sales cycles and improves client confidence.
If you're a game developer, Midjourney generates concept art rapidly. Environment concepts, character designs, and visual direction exploration take hours in traditional art; Midjourney produces dozens of directions in 30 minutes.
If you're a filmmaker, Midjourney creates mood boards and visual references. Describe a scene's lighting and composition, generate references, and share with your cinematographer. This accelerates production design and ensures everyone envisions the same aesthetic.

Who Should NOT Use Midjourney
If you need API integration (bulk image generation in an application), Midjourney isn't available. DALL-E's API and Stable Diffusion's API are better for developers.
If you need video generation, Midjourney doesn't offer it. Runway, Pika, and other video AI tools are required.
If you need precise text within images (logos with exact lettering, labeled diagrams), Midjourney struggles. Manual editing is often required. DALL-E 3 has improved here but still isn't perfect.
If you prefer a desktop application interface, Midjourney's Discord dependency feels clunky. Competitors with standalone apps (Krita with AI plugins, ComfyUI) might feel more natural.
If you're doing technical or diagram-heavy work (data visualization, engineering drawings), Midjourney isn't ideal. These require structured layouts that text-to-image struggles with.
